CHAPTER 20
________________
The three dooplehuel were close to Spitzbergen by the time the sun set. The Valkrethi were already in the cave Menon had prepared for them, when Hudnee and the others sailed past. They had a long way to go yet. Relying on the stars above them, the villagers continued down the coast in the darkness, each dooplehuel steered by one of the crew as the others slept.
They didn’t see the cliffs of Spitzbergen end, or the swamps of the eastern wastelands begin. Around the middle of the night they started to angle in toward the shore, and when dawn came they were running in to the coast with the islands of the Barrens dead ahead. The villagers called them the Teeth.
“Perfect,” said Hudnee, as he stood, balancing carefully in the front of one of the narrow hulls, surveying their position. “Now we just have to find Blood river and make it to one of the islands. We’ll have an excellent view from there.”
“Not long to Blood river,” said one of the men behind him. “I can see the Pillar and the Scouse starting to line up. When they do, we follow the shore down until we hit the Blood.”
Hudnee nodded. He was looking forward to the coming battle. They all were. The vast underwater ring of the Invardii base, and the giants he had been told the Alliance was bringing. It should be quite a show.
The main force of Javelins came out of star drive well above the atmosphere but directly over the Barrens. Every Hud pilot on Prometheus had volunteered for this mission as soon as it was announced. They were keen to rid their home planet of the Invardii presence, whatever the cost.
Hud pilots now controlled more than half the 320 Javelins Prometheus could field. It was they, plus the Human pilots of the modified Javelins carrying the Valkrethi, that looked down on a ring of islands bordering a large, flat continent, far below them.
“Remember not to get excited, and rush the job,” said Ayman Case, now Commodore Case and mission leader while Cagill led the Valkrethi. He was speaking to the task force that had been assembled for the attack on the Barrens.
“Our job is to draw out the destruction of the mining base, and draw in as many of the Reaper ships as we can.”
He knew there would be an orchestrated nodding of heads in the Javelins arrayed around him. These were experienced pilots and technicians, most from the planet below and all hardened to the grueling demands of war. They would live and die depending on each other, and they would stick to the plan. Any ideas of personal glory had been stripped from them long ago.
“Sensors on the Sea Anemone are plotting the Barrens topography now,” he continued, “expect data in a few minutes.”
The sensor array on the Sea Anemone – a modified Javelin containing surveillance equipment – had already extended to its full width. The strange, ungainly blob with its ‘feeding mouth’ fully open did look like a sea anemone filtering sea water for scraps of food.
